Christine M. Plasencia took her Bachelors of Applied Arts from Central Michigan University in Violin Performance. She continued her studies in music education and violin performance under Michael Barta at Southern Illinois University. During this time she was an in-demand performer, playing with the Springfield Symphony, Saginaw Symphony, and Memphis Symphony, amongst others. Having taught privately for over twenty years, she uses various methods, including Suzuki, Mark O’Connor and traditional methods, to meet the needs of each particular student. She currently teaches violin, viola, cello, and piano out of studios in Thousand Oaks and Oxnard. 

Mrs. Plasencia currently teaches violin and music to incarcerated youth at Providence School in Oxnard; Mrs. Plasencia is the Orchestra Director at St. John’s Lutheran Church School, in Oxnard. Mrs. Plasencia continues to perform classically, playing with the Windsong Quartet. She is the band leader of Segue, a jazz quintet which features Christine on jazz violin.
